Basic Information

Product Name (3-Allyl-4-Hydroxybenzyl)Formamide
CAS No. 1201633-41-1
Molecular Formula C11H13NO2
Molecular Weight 191.23 g/mol
Synonyms N-[(3-Allyl-4-hydroxyphenyl)methyl]formamide; 4-(Allyl)-2-(formamidomethyl)phenol; Formamide, N-[(3-allyl-4-hydroxyphenyl)methyl]-; (3-Allyl-4-hydroxybenzyl)carboxamide; Allylhydroxybenzylformamide

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(typically 15-25°C). Keep away from strong oxidizing agents and incompatible materials.
